The purpose of this communication is to inform you that the City of Nashua has made a donation of
surplus supplies and equipment at NIMCO to the Nashua International Sculpture Symposium. This
material was not sold at auction and is considered to have a low value as scrap metal. The Symposium
can use the supplies and equipment to help meet their needs. Images are included to identify the items
in this donation.
§ 5-88. Surplus stock.
[NRO 1975, T. 4, § 1618; NRO 1987, § 2-253; amended 11-26-1977 by Ord. No. O-77-278; 4-22-1986 by
Ord. No. 0-86-50; 6-28-1988 by Ord. No. O-88-43]
All using agencies shall submit to the Purchasing Manager, at such times and in such form as he shall
prescribe, reports showing stocks of all supplies which are no longer used or which have become
obsolete, worn out or scrapped.
The Manager shall have the authority to transfer surplus stock to other using agencies. The Manager
shall have the authority to sell, by sealed bid or online auction, all supplies which have become unsuitable
for public use, or to exchange the same for, or trade in the same on, new supplies.
[Amended 10-9-2012 by Ord. No. O-12-022]
With approval, the Purchasing Manager may donate, barter, gift or otherwise dispose of surplus material,
stock or equipment which has failed to be sold, exchanged or traded pursuant to Subsection B.
